In Palworld, Pals have attributes called Passive Skills, which provide them with buffs and debuffs. The game features over a hundred different creatures called Pals that you can catch and explore the world with. Depending on their work suitability, Pals can assist with various tasks, such as mining, logging, and watering. With the right Passive Skills, a Pal can become significantly more efficient at its job.

There are many types of Passive Skills in Palworld, but among them, Rainbow Passive Pal Skills are the rarest. While a few Rainbow Passives are exclusive to specific Pals—such as Bellanoir’s Siren of the Void and Xenoguard’s Invader—others have a tiny chance of appearing on all Pals.

Since Rainbow Passives are highly sought after, many players wonder how to obtain them in Palworld. This guide provides a complete list of Rainbow Passive Skills and the best methods to acquire them.

All Rainbow Passive Skills in Palworld

Palworld - Legend Passive Jetragon

There are 13 Rainbow Passive Skills in Palworld—four exclusive and nine non-exclusive. Some are guaranteed to appear on certain boss Pals, while others are entirely RNG-based. Below is a list of all Rainbow Passive Skills in Palworld, their effects, and which Pals can obtain them.

Passive Skill

Effect

Pals

Legend (Exclusive)

Attack +20%, Defense +20%, Movement Speed Increase +15%

Jetragon, Frostallion, Frostallion Noct, Necromus, Paladius

Siren of the Void (Exclusive)

30% increase in Dark attack damage, 30% increase in Ice attack damage

Bellanoir Libero

Eternal Flame (Exclusive)

30% increase in Fire attack damage, 30% increase in Lightning attack damage

Blazamut Ryu

Invader (Exclusive)

30% increase in Dark attack damage, 30% increase in Dragon attack damage

Xenolord

Lucky

Work Speed +15%, Attack +15%

Random

Vampiric

Absorbs a portion of damage dealt to restore Health, does not sleep at night and continues to work

Random

Heart of the Immovable King

SAN drops +20.0% slower

Random

Eternal Engine

Max Stamina +75%

Random

Swift

30% increase to Movement Speed

Random

Mastery of Fasting

Hunger decreases +20.0% slower

Random

Diamond Body

Defense +30%

Random

Remarkable Craftsmanship

Work Speed +75%

Random

Demon God

Attack +30%, Defense +5%

Random

Rainbow Passive Skills listed as Exclusive are found only on specific Pals. The Legend Passive Skill is guaranteed to appear on Legendary Alpha Jetragon, Frostallion, Frostallion Noct, Necromus, and Paladius. The other three Exclusive skills are only available on Pals hatched from eggs dropped by Ultra Raid bosses.

As for the non-exclusive Rainbow Passive Skills, they have an extremely low chance of appearing on a Pal.

Once you find a Pal with a Rainbow Passive Skill, you can breed it with other Pals to pass down the skill. Below, we discuss the best ways to obtain non-exclusive Rainbow Passive Skills in Palworld.

Palworld: Best Way to Get Rainbow Passive Skills

Every Pal has an extremely low chance of possessing Rainbow Passive Skills. While the exact probability is unknown, players may need to capture hundreds of Pals before encountering one with this skill—unless they get lucky. Aside from Rainbow Passives, a Pal can also have anywhere between one and four Passive Skills from a pool of over 70 unique skills, which further reduces the chances of obtaining rare skills.

Here are some efficient ways to increase your chances of obtaining a Pal with Rainbow Passive Skills:

1) Capturing Low-Level Pals

The best way to get Rainbow Passives is by capturing low-level Pals in starter regions where they spawn in large numbers. If you have progressed in Palworld, returning to the starter island can be a great way to begin your hunt. Players at level 30 or above are recommended to visit Gobfin’s Turf.

Gobfin’s Turf is arguably the best location for farming new Passive Skills in Palworld. It features a flat terrain where Gobfins spawn in groups of 3-4. Endgame players can craft a Scatter Sphere Launcher and use multiple Giga Spheres or Mega Spheres to capture multiple Gobfins at once.

Here are some additional tips to improve your farming efficiency:

  • Free up your Pal inventory. You will likely capture hundreds of Pals before obtaining one with a Rainbow Passive Skill.
  • Set up a Pal Essence Condenser. Most Pals you capture will have useless Passive Skills. Use the condenser to refine Pals with better abilities and free up inventory space.
  • Use a Pal Disassembly Conveyor. Players at level 47 can craft this machine to butcher multiple Pals at once, clearing inventory space efficiently.
  • Adjust world settings. If you do not mind modifying settings, increase the Pal Appearance Rate to 3. This will triple the number of Pals that spawn, increasing capture opportunities.
  • Stock up on Pal Spheres. Capture Vixy with a level 5 Partner Skill. This ranch Pal can dig up Hyper, Giga, Mega, and regular Pal Spheres for free.

2) Dr. Brawn

Palworld - Dr. Brawn

Dr. Brawn is a mysterious NPC who has an extremely low chance of appearing at random spots across the Palpagos Islands. He can replace or add a new Passive Skill to a Pal once per day, but finding him is far from easy.

Dr. Brawn has a small chance to spawn at special incident locations. Here are some coordinates near fast travel points where he might appear:

  • (-231, -576) & (-226, -488): Southwest and north of Small Cove (Sea Breeze Archipelago)
  • (-91, -460) & (-94, -437): West and north of Sealed Realm of the Swordmaster (Alpha Bushi)
  • (-229, -325) & (-198, -380): North and south of Sealed Realm of the Thunder Dragon (Alpha Relaxauras Lux)
  • (-479, -61) & (-413, -9): South and east of Forgotten Island Church Ruins
  • (-11, -383): South of Bridge of the Twin Knights
  • (-598, -510): Near Eternal Pyre Tower Entrance

To increase your chances of finding Dr. Brawn, travel between two of these coordinates until he spawns. Once located, summon your Pal and interact with him to assign a random Passive Skill. Note that he may also increase or decrease a Pal’s stats, depending on whether the skill is positive or negative.

Dr. Brawn is a level 50 NPC. Like other humans in Palworld, he can be captured, though due to his high level, you may need an Ultimate Sphere. If captured, you can bring him to your base, allowing him to perform surgery daily until he grants a Pal the Rainbow Passive Skill you are looking for.

3) Breeding Pals with No Skills

Palworld - Rainbow Passive Skill from Breeding

Another method is to breed two Pals that have no Passive Skills, hoping their offspring will inherit the Rainbow Passive Skill. If two Pals have Passive Skills, their offspring are highly likely to inherit the same set of skills. However, breeding Pals without any Passive Skills increases the chance of their offspring obtaining random abilities, including the rare and valuable Demon God. You can use two Pals with the Philanthropist Passive Skill, which increases breeding speed by 100%. This will help produce eggs faster.

You can rotate between these three strategies to maximize your chances of obtaining Rainbow Passive Skills. However, acquiring them relies heavily on RNG, and it may take many hours of farming. Once you finally obtain a Rainbow Passive Pal, you can breed it with others to pass down the skill.

Once you have a Pal with a Rainbow Passive Skill, try passing it down to a Yakumo and condensing that Yakumo to enhance its Partner Skill, Birds of a Feather. At max level, Yakumo has a 30% chance to encounter Pals that share its Passive Skill.

This means that if you have a Yakumo with the Demon God Passive Skill, you will have a much higher chance of encountering Demon God Pals.
